Remediation Strategies

Southern Research develops water and wastewater remediation strategies based on problematic constituents that have been identified. Strategies are developed using biogeochemical data (thermodynamic and/or kinetic software models), experimental results from gray and published manuscripts, and data from previous laboratory experiments. Specifically, Southern Research engineers utilize these data sources to design small-scale physical models (i.e., treatment systems) that can be evaluated to determine the system's performance for site-specific waters.
